(2.) The petitioners in this writ application, has prayed for a direction upon the
respondents to consider their case for allotment of shop at Jail Road, Chaibasa.
(3.) Facts of the petitioners' case in brief is that the petitioners were earlier running
small business on the flank of the Jail Road Boundary at Chaibasa. In course of antiencroachment
drive, the petitioners along with several other similarly situated
shopkeepers, were displaced from the said place. Subsequently, a scheme was floated by
the local administration for rehabilitation of such displaced shopkeepers at a suitable /
appropriate place.
It appears that at the same site from where the shopkeepers were earlier displaced,
new shop rooms have been constructed and applications have been invited for allotment
and certain amounts have been received by the concerned authorities from the various
applicants with an assurance of allotment of shops to them.;
